SLFeDNAcleveland

Data associated with the manuscript, "eDNA sampling detects early colonization of Spotted Lanternfly Lycorma delicatula better than in-person scouting in an urban landscape"

Location = location name within Cleveland, OH Year = year of sampling Method = either 'visual scouting' or 'eDNA collection' to assess the presence of spotted lanternfly at each site Totalsamsite = total number of samples taken with the year of sampling Positive = total number of positive indications of spotted lanternfly within each method Negative = total number of negative indications of spotted lanternfly within each method tohpre = presence or absence of tree of heaven (0,1) densityTOH = relative density of tree of heaven as determined by the number of TOH stands and density within each stand (ordinal, 0= lowest density, whereas 4 would be greatest density) dis10 = proportion of land considered 'disturbed' as defined by the ArcGIS (https://hub.arcgis.com/datasets/tlcgis::disturbed-lands-view/explore) for10 = proportion of land considered 'forest cover' as defined by the ArcGIS (https://hub.arcgis.com/datasets/tlcgis::disturbed-lands-view/explore) rail_dist = closest railine to sampling site (Ohio transportion)
